  • Here's my Pot of Gold - made for a gift. I used a 59p jar from Ikea which had a silvery coloured plastic top on it. I decoupaged the top with gold tissue papers and then used Mod Podge and put glitter in the last coat.

    th_DSC03071.jpg

    I just need to put a couple fo scratch cards in it now and wrap it in Cellophane nearer the time.
